ordinary day on November 17 1906. however it was also the birth of soichiro Honda who would go on to change the world in more ways than one Honda's father was a blacksmith who had a bicycle repair shop whilst his mother worked as a weaver their family was very poor and of Honda's eight siblings five of them died during childhood due to poor health however as Honda grew up he became very interested in tools and machines and was especially keen on learning how Vehicles worked after we saw his first car a Ford Model T whilst he was just a toddler he chased after it mesmerized by its design that memory and the smell of the oil would stay with him forever now around this time bicycles were becoming very popular all over Japan and customers began to line up in front of his father's repair shop Honda spent a lot of time watching his dad work and then practicing repairs himself Honda even learned how to make his own toys from whatever materials he saw lying around within a few years Honda was regularly helping his dad out in the repair shop however when it came to academic learning Honda did terribly in school he just wasn't interested in what they were teaching and longed to be back in his father's Workshop instead since he lacked interest in school his grades suffered the class were given reports with their grades on which they were meant to take to their parents who would then stamp a family seal on it to show they'd seen the report card however Honda didn't want his parents to see he was failing and disappoint them so he decided to create a family seal using a scrap rubber bicycle pedal cover so that his teacher would think his parents had stamped her and it worked in fact it worked so well that other kids in his class who were afraid of showing their low grades to their parents came to him asking if he could create family seals for them as well so they didn't have to show their parents their report card eventually though Honda got caught and his dad wasn't mad he'd done it his dad was mad his work had been sloppy enough to get found out despite not getting much of a formal education Honda was quickly developing his skills in his father's workshop and had a genuine fascination with machinery and Engineering then in 1917 when Honda was 11 years old he heard that a pilot named Art Smith was going to demonstrate the aerobatic cape abilities of the biplane so he decided to borrow some money from the petty cash box took one of the bicycles in his father's shop and rode for 20 kilometers to the military's Airfield to watch the show except when he got there he realized he didn't actually have enough money for the admission fee so he decided to climb up a tree to watch the demonstration Honda found it incredible and this only increased his love for machinery and invention but when he returned home his father had discovered what had happened luckily instead of being angry Honda's father was far more impressed of his son's determination and initiative and perhaps deep down he was proud his son had the same appreciation for engineering that he did so he let the incident pass foreign [Music] in 1922 after finishing school Honda spotted an advertisement in a newspaper for a car servicing company named art chokai the ad said assistant wanted for auto repair shop in Tokyo he figured that if the company could afford to be running ads like this maybe they'd have spaces available for apprenticeships for young men like him wanting to get into the trade so at the age of just 15 he decided to leave home in search of a job and headed to Tokyo going from his small village to the bustling streets of Tokyo was an intense experience but his hunch had been right and he was able to get an apprenticeship working at Art Show Kai garage unfortunately on his first day he was given the job of cleaning up scrubbing the dirty floors and preparing meals for the owners in fact he would often end up babysitting the owner's child so not exactly what he'd had in mind plus apprenticeships at the time weren't paid so he was merely given a small space to rest and a bit of food to eat but soon after joining an earthquake hit Tokyo which caused many of the mechanics to have to leave work for a while to repair their homes the auto repair shop was now understaffed and hunt finally got his chance as he was asked to fill in as a mechanic by working extremely hard this role was soon made permanent Honda was eager to learn and spent his days repairing cars and motorcycles which at the time were limited to only the upper class it was here that Honda encountered a very wide range of vehicles from all different manufacturers which sharpened his knowledge even more Honda would always take a lot of care in examining each vehicle assigned to him for repair and on his work breaks he'd read whatever car related magazines he could get his hands on it wasn't long before Honda was not just repairing vehicles but designing spare parts as well given that Honda was doing a lot of great work for this company one of the owners named uzo took it upon himself to educate Honda about the business side of the trade as well as the technical side yuzo was the ideal Mentor for Honda and it was him who introduced Honda to the world of Motorsports you see in 1923 user had decided to begin manufacturing his own race car and he asked Honda to help him out with building it their second design which they named the Curtis ended up winning the 1924 Japanese Motorcar Championship Honda was on board as the accompanying engineer and this victory at a young age both winning the race and the thrill of helping to build something like this was a feeling he'd never forget and a feeling he had continued to Chase [Music] when he turned 20 Honda was called up to fulfill his obligations in military service however during the medical examination it was found out he was colorblind and he was excused from Duty shortly after this in 1928 his mentor the owner of art show Kai presented him with an opportunity saying that he wanted Honda to set up his own branch of archokai in hamamatsu a Japanese City very close to the village where Honda was born given Honda was still in his early twenties it was a lot of responsibility to run his own auto repair shop but he clearly impressed his managers and so Honda gladly accepted Honda's Branch grew slowly at first it was just him running it all by himself initially and when people brought their cars in for repairs some were put off by how young he seemed assuming that he was inexperienced but he eventually managed to build up a good reputation in the area and by the mid-1930s he'd managed to hire a full team to help at last Honda was making good money for himself he'd worked his way up from an unpaid Apprentice looking after his boss's baby to running his own successful auto repair shop and as a rich young man Honda was never shy about having a good time there are many reports of him enjoying himself in the company of lots of geishas stories of him throwing parties and even dancing nude at his wedding Honda worked hard but he partied even harder however sometimes his Knights of drinking did not end so well there was one incident whilst drunk where he accidentally knocked a geisha out of a window from the second floor fortunately she survived by landing on some wires although they reportedly had to cut the electrical wires to save the woman which resulted in the entire town experiencing an electrical power outage Honda also continued to enjoy racing but that too would nearly end in a fatal disaster when in 1936 Honda was involved in a serious car crash during the Japanese high-speed rally that forced him to quit racing completely he spent three months in hospital and had a permanent scar for the rest of his life the doctors commented that he was lucky to get out alive at all the incident was a wake-up call for Honda suddenly having an influx of wealth had led him to a bit of a Playboy Daredevil lifestyle but several Close Encounters had made him reevaluate what he really wanted he realized that even though his auto repair shop was doing well he was dissatisfied with car repair it was time for a new and bigger challenge foreign [Music] Hondas saw a lot of potential in manufacturing and asked Art Show Kai if he could turn his auto repair shop he was running for them into a separate company where he would produce piston rings unfortunately our chokai did not like this idea at all the business was doing well and making a lot of money they had no interest in stopping that and entering a whole new field especially since producing their own car parts rather than repairing them seemed like a lot more risk and cost however Honda was determined to pursue his new vision so he and a friend decided to go into business together setting up their own separate business called Tokai Seiko heavy industry at first Honda would still spend his days working at his repair shop and then spend his nights working on this new car park Manufacturing Company he'd started trying to create piston rings it was exhausting trying to do both though and he didn't get much sleep he also took evening classes to improve its understanding of metals and Alloys and for two years he worked tirelessly until he reached a revolutionary piston design breakthrough in 1939 at this point he turned over his duties at Art Show Kai to his trainees and began to fully focus on this new manufacturing company they began piston production and for the first time in a while underfelt truly excited by his work again but that excitement was short-lived as they were soon bombarded with manufacturing challenges for example they received an order from Toyota but of the thousands of Pistons they ordered from Honda's company only three past Toyota's high quality standards it was a big setback but Honda decided he'd go visit universities and factories all over Japan to further understand the manufacturing process and develop his skills further eventually he obtained enough knowledge and skill that he was able to produce piston rings that passed Toyota's quality standards and better yet Honda figured out a way to mass produce them using an automated process which meant even unskilled laborers could produce them this meant he was able to produce them in bulk at a relatively low cost orders rapidly increased and since Honda couldn't keep up with the man from his Workshop he opened a factory to mass produce the piston rings unfortunately just as Honda's manufacturing business was really taking off Japan was gearing up for war when Japan entered World War II in 1941 many of Honda's male employees were called for military service leaving Honda's plan with lots of vacant positions the war also meant that there were a lot of supply shortages and Honda had difficulty sourcing materials when enemy planes dropped fuel cans out of the sky Underwood tell his employees to look for the Fallen cans as they could still be used for manufacturing that's how desperate for supplies he was in 1944 it was beginning to look like Japan would lose the war and when a bomb was dropped on one of Honda's factories it looked like he might lose his business in another cruel twist just a year later Hunter's other Factory would be destroyed in an earthquake it was so destroying that what he'd spent years building was quite literally turned to Rubble the company had already been struggling immensely because of the war but this was the final nail in the coffin for his company he was going out of business so Honda sold whatever was left of his manufacturing business to Toyota [Music] thank you there was a massive fuel shortage after the war and transportation at this time was limited mostly to bicycles people needed a way to get around easily and cheaply whilst being extremely fuel efficient so Honda had an idea he attached a small motor to his bike which soon caught the attention of people all around the city sensing this could be a good solution to his country's problems Honda created the Honda technical Research Institute in 1946 using the money he had left after selling his piston ring manufacturing business the sole purpose of this was to figure out the best way to make motorbikes using some Surplus military engines Honda had managed to obtain he was able to successfully build working motorbikes that immediately became a hit in Japan soon he was flooded with orders and ran out of used engines so under developed his own engine however to be able to mass produce enough motorbikes to fulfill the demand Honda needed more money to invest in production and unfortunately in the league economic conditions following the war investment was not easily available but as always Honda found away he reportedly wrote letters to 18 000 bicycle shop owners across the country explaining his idea and asking him to invest in his new motorbike design three thousand of those bicycle shop owners wrote back to say they'd invest in Honda's motorbikes so Honda was back in business Honda Motors Co was incorporated in 1948 to manufacture small capacity motorcycles with the goal of producing an affordable motorbike which would help Japanese people more easily get around Honda also teamed up with business partner takio fujisawa Who provided not only additional investment for the company but also was a great business operator and strategist allowing Honda more time to devote to the product side of the business Honda's first fully fledged motorbike was the d-type which stood for dream although it was a bit too bulky and heavy but Honda soon found success with a new and improved model called the Super Cub which was lighter smaller and safer and an immediate success orders poured in from all over the country Honda then turned its focus to entering the U.
